Defining Maintenance

Maintenance, as a practice, involves the process of inspecting, repairing, and maintaining equipment, machinery, and facilities to ensure their optimal functionality and prolong their lifespan. This encompasses a wide range of tasks, from routine checks and adjustments to more extensive repairs and replacements. There are several types of maintenance, including preventative, corrective, and predictive, each serving a unique purpose. Preventative maintenance focuses on performing regular upkeep to prevent potential failures, while corrective maintenance involves addressing issues after they have occurred. Predictive maintenance, on the other hand, leverages data-driven insights to anticipate equipment failures and take the necessary action to mitigate downtime. By understanding and implementing these various approaches, organizations can greatly enhance their overall efficiency, reliability, and safety.

Key Elements of a Successful Maintenance Program

A successful maintenance program is vital for organizations to ensure the optimal performance and longevity of their assets. By implementing key elements within the program, companies can proactively address maintenance needs, improve efficiency, and minimize downtime. Let's explore the essential elements that contribute to the effectiveness of a maintenance program.


A. Effective Planning and Scheduling: A well-organized maintenance program hinges on effective planning and scheduling. This involves strategically mapping out maintenance activities, including routine inspections, preventive maintenance tasks, and repairs. By planning ahead, organizations can optimize resource allocation, minimize disruptions to operations, and maximize the utilization of maintenance personnel and equipment. Scheduling maintenance activities at appropriate times ensures that assets receive the necessary attention while minimizing interference with production or service delivery.


B. Regular Inspections and Monitoring: Regular inspections and monitoring play a vital role in detecting potential issues before they escalate into major problems. Conducting thorough inspections allows maintenance teams to identify early signs of wear and tear, equipment deterioration, or performance deviations. By implementing a proactive approach, organizations can address minor maintenance needs promptly, preventing costly breakdowns, and reducing the likelihood of unplanned downtime. Continuous monitoring, through various techniques such as condition monitoring or predictive analytics, provides real-time insights into asset health, enabling timely intervention and optimized maintenance planning.


C. Employee Training and Development: Skilled and knowledgeable maintenance personnel are essential for a successful maintenance program. Investing in employee training and development ensures that technicians and engineers possess the necessary expertise to handle complex machinery and equipment. Ongoing training programs not only enhance technical skills but also promote a safety culture, familiarize employees with evolving technologies, and encourage innovative problem-solving. Well-trained maintenance teams can execute tasks efficiently, troubleshoot effectively, and make informed decisions, ultimately contributing to improved asset performance and reliability.


D. Utilization of Technology and Data Analytics: Leveraging technology and data analytics is increasingly critical for maintenance programs in today's digital era. Advanced tools and software, such as computerized maintenance management systems (CMMS) and asset management platforms, enable streamlined maintenance workflows, comprehensive asset tracking, and data-driven decision-making. By collecting and analyzing data on equipment performance, usage patterns, and maintenance history, organizations can identify trends, anticipate maintenance requirements, optimize maintenance intervals, and allocate resources effectively. Predictive and prescriptive analytics empower maintenance teams to shift from reactive to proactive strategies, minimizing unplanned downtime and maximizing asset availability.
